Welcome,

I would centrally mount otherwise the bikes will over hang the side of the van, not only being illegal but can cause major problems when negotiating narrow entrances & lanes. We recently into an entrance with a building on both sides less than 100mm clearance from each side mirror.

Hi and welcome :thumb: Mount central :thumb: buy a stud detector or tap the rear very lightly with a hammer,listening to the sound to find the batons, then fix your rack to them remembering to seal any screw holes :thumb: Why do you have to remove the cooker ?
